One of Sun Devils’ top targets of the 2022 class has set his commitment date. Four-star linebacker Devon Jackson from Omaha, Neb. will make a decision between Arizona State, Oregon and Miami on Oct. 2.

Jackson is currently rated as 247Sports’ 154th overall recruit, 18th best linebacker and Nebraska’s second top recruit. Dozens of Power Five schools offered Jackson including Auburn, Iowa, LSU, Michigan, Notre Dame, Oklahoma, Ole Miss, Texas A&M and more.
For Sun Devil fans, the tea leaves don’t read in your favor. At one point according to 247Sports Crystal Ball, Arizona State was the favorite to land Jackson at one point. Since the news broke of the NCAA’s investgatiion, however, all four experts have flipped their predictions to Oregon.
Jackson also recently took a visit to Eugene, Ore. on Sept. 28 and visited Miami over the summer without an official visit to Tempe. Jackson’s friend from Omaha, Deshawn Woods, also appeared to be headed to Tempe, but picked Missouri back in July.
